## Onboarding: Ferndrop Password Reset Revamp

The new reset flow replaces emailed links with short-lived codes verified in-app. Support agents can trigger a manual reset from the Ferndrop admin panel, but only after the customer clears identity checks. If the admin panel itself is locked out during an incident, escalation uses the support recovery passphrase, noted immediately below for the on-shift lead.

unlock words, hahip-baduf: holwyn-istath-julvan

## Artifact Signing: Clock Skew on Build Agents

The Pellwick build farm signs artifacts with timestamps from each agent's local clock. Agents vellum-03 and vellum-07 have drifted up to 41 seconds, causing verification failures when signatures appear to predate their parent commits. Until NTP remediation lands, reviewers should allow a 60-second tolerance window. Verification must still be performed against the current release key, reproduced below.

deploy key for kajof-fajop: bky6_gDHw9Q

Subject: Quickstore 4.2 — bloom filter now fronts the KV layer

Plugin authors: starting with this release, Quickstore places a bloom filter ahead of the key-value store. Negative lookups return faster; false positives fall through safely. No API changes are required on your side. Verify your plugin against the staging build referenced below.

session token of fahif-tadup = htk3_9c7